Solar Energy for Boilers

Solar energy can be harnessed effectively to power boilers, providing a lasting and eco-friendly alternative to traditional fossil fuel-based systems. https://tunbridgewellsplumber.co.uk/index.html

By utilizing solar thermal technology or photovoltaic panels, warmth from the sun can be converted into usable energy for heating system water or generating steam. Solar thermal systems use collectors to soak up sunshine and convert it into warmth, which is then used in a fluid to create warm water. This warm water can be used directly in a boiler for heating system purposes.

On the other hand, photovoltaic sections convert sunshine into electricity, which may be utilized to power electric powered boilers, reducing reliance on grid electricity.

Implementing solar energy for boilers presents several advantages. It reduces greenhouse gas emissions, decreases dependency on nonrenewable resources, and plays a part in energy cost savings over time.

Additionally, solar technology systems possess minimal maintenance requirements and will operate efficiently in a variety of climates.

Geothermal Solutions for Heating

Geothermal solutions for heating leverage the Earth's organic heat to provide a competent and sustainable substitute for powering boilers. By experiencing geothermal temperature, which hails from the ground resource, boilers can operate with lower energy consumption and reduced environmental impact.

Ground source temperature pumps are generally used in geothermal systems for heating system applications. These pumps extract heat from the ground during winter season to warm the fluid that circulates within the machine, which is after that used to temperature buildings or drinking water. This process is normally reversed during summer months to cool inside spaces by transferring high temperature in the building back into the ground.

Geothermal solutions offer a constant and dependable heat source irrespective of external climate, making them a dependable option for boiler operation. Additionally, geothermal systems have a long lifespan and require minimal maintenance, adding to cost savings over time.

Incorporating geothermal heat into boiler operations can easily appreciably enhance energy efficiency and decrease greenhouse gas emissions.

Biomass Options for Boiler Energy

Making use of biomass as a fuel source for boilers presents a sustainable and renewable option that can greatly reduce carbon emissions and reliance on fossil fuels.

Biomass choices for boiler gas include pellet fuels, wood potato chips, agricultural residues, energy crops, and biogas production.

Pellet fuels, created from compressed organic matter such as solid wood, crop residues, or grasses, give efficient combustion and consistent heating system.

Wood potato chips, sourced from forestry residues or devoted tree farms, give a cost-effective and accessible biomass energy.

Agricultural residues, like straw or corn stover, and energy crops such as switchgrass or willow trees, offer additional lasting biomass choices for boiler fuel.

Biogas production from organic waste streams may also be converted into a renewable fuel resource for boilers.

Ensuring sustainable sourcing practices for biomass fuels is vital to maintain the environmental benefits of using biomass in boilers.

Blowing wind Power Integration for Boilers

Incorporating wind power into boiler systems provides a appealing avenue for enhancing energy efficiency and reducing carbon footprints.

Wind turbine integration involves connecting wind-generated electricity towards the grid, which can then be utilized to power boilers. This integration requires efficient energy storage space solutions to manage fluctuations in wind energy creation.

Blowing wind energy storage technologies such as for example batteries or pumped hydro storage space can store excessive energy during high blowing wind periods for later make use of when winds are quiet.

Hydroelectricity for Boiler Procedures

Hydroelectricity plays a crucial part in optimizing boiler procedures by harnessing the power of flowing drinking water to generate power. Incorporating hydroelectric power into boiler systems gives a sustainable heating answer that decreases reliance on fossil fuels.

Hydroelectric power plants convert the kinetic energy of water into electricity through turbines linked to generators. This process provides a consistent and reliable source of renewable energy for running boilers.

By utilizing hydroelectricity for boiler operations, industries may notably lower their carbon footprint and overall environmental impact. The continuous era of power from hydroelectric power ensures a stable energy source for heating system processes, promoting effectiveness and cost-effectiveness.
